SUMMARY:Tai Ji Quan: Moving for Better Balance Austintown Senior Center
DESCRIPTION:Tai Ji Quan: Moving for Better Balance® (TJQMBB) is a research-based balance training regimen designed for older adults at risk of falling and people with balance disorders. Fuzhong Li\, Ph.D.\, a Senior Scientist at Oregon Research Institute\, developed the program. \nAlthough its origin can be traced to the contemporary simplified 24-form Tai Ji Quan routine\, TJQMBB represents a significant paradigm shift in the application of Tai Ji Quan\, moving the focus from its historical use as a martial art or recreational activity to propagating health by addressing common\, but potentially debilitating\, functional impairments/deficits. \nThis unique training approach is the culmination of a systematic series of scientific studies to improve efficacy\, utility\, and community and clinical relevance. \nThis FREE course runs Tuesdays and Thursdays from 9am-10am from 1/2/24 to 6/27/24.
